I will tell you now that Craigslist is definitely not the place to be looking for a specific breed of dog, as people will post anything to sell or rehome a dog/puppy. You can search for breeders' web pages for an American Bully, if that's definitely what you're looking for. There are a few reputable breeders out there who are breeding correct dogs. The only sites where you'll find names and pictures of the dogs are either on breeders' web sites or on bully pedia looking at a specific pedigree. 1. Ruffian is Amstaff, founded mostly off heavy Tudor dogs and is one of the 5 original AST lines (the other lines being Tacoma, X-Pert, Crusader and California) 2. Greyline is an AmBully line most probably descended off various AST dogs 3. Swoggers, whether ppl agree or not, is an APBT rednose line. The founder, Kim Swogger, based most of her dogs off the Lar-Sen and Wilrox lines and POSSIBLY some early DZ or Camelot. Not deep game bred for the box, but drivey, large bone show n go. Outcrossed with the Greco (Castillo) and Boogieman bloodlines, these dogs excelled in weight pull and catch work (hogs)
